  • Deeper Waters Podcast 1/30/2016: Daniel Rodger

    We talk about abortion with someone across the pond next week.

    The link can be found here.

    The text is as follows:

    What's coming up on the next episode of the Deeper Waters Podcast? Let's plunge into the Deeper Waters and find out.

    January is the month that I prefer to tackle the topic of the evil of abortion. As I had said on the last episode, when the Canaanites sacrificed their children, while it was certainly a wicked act, one could say they did it for the good of the harvest and in the long run the community as a whole. When we do it today, we sacrifice our children at the altar of convenience. This isn't something that's going away any time soon and the recent debacle involving Planned Parenthood is an example of that. We in America are seeing this all go on and many of us have hopes that we can change our society to remove this evil.

    But how do things look across the pond?

    To discuss that, I decided to interview someone from over there. My guest this next Saturday will be Daniel Rodger. Who is he?

    kings college card.jpg

    According to his bio:

    I work in the NHS and have an undergraduate degree in Religious Studies & History and a Masters degree in Ethics. I also work as a prolife apologist for Life Training Institute here in the UK, and also run the UK Apologetics Facebook group and tweet @failedatheist.

    He also wanted me to mention that he loves being a cultural agitator. Yeah. I think we're going to get along well.

    How are things in the UK when it comes to the topic of abortion. For instance, the UK is seen as a far more secular country than the US is. Also, the UK has a much more nationalized health care system. Does this make a difference? What are the political debates going on around the topic of abortion?

    Of course, we'll more generally discuss the case for the life of the unborn and why abortion is wrong and should be seen as wrong. We will ask the hard questions about the topic of abortion that are often raised by pro-abortion advocates and discuss issues of freedom and liberty. Again, things could be different across the pond in a country where the Constitution isn't exactly being debated.

    Naturally, I hope to discuss something that is going on here in America and that's the Planned Parenthood issue. Recently, we have seen this surface again and Christians are debating if the indictment is a good thing or a bad thing. I've seen some see it as a huge miscarriage of justice. I've also seen some look at it and say that this means Planned Parenthood itself will have to go to trial and the world will get to see just how twisted that they are. Does Daniel Rodger have any opinions on this and what does he think of the concept of going undercover to collect information from Planned Parenthood anyway?
